Course Details
• Disaster-Resistant Design Fundamentals: Understanding the principles of disaster-resistant architecture, including hazard assessment, structural integrity, and sustainable design.
• Seismic Resistance Techniques: Exploring seismic-resistant design strategies, such as base isolation, shear wall systems, and moment-resisting frames.
• Hurricane-Resistant Structures: Examining building techniques to withstand high winds and storm surges, including elevated structures, impact-resistant glazing, and reinforced connections.
• Flood-Resistant Design: Learning about flood-resistant materials, elevated foundations, and waterproofing techniques to protect buildings from floodwaters.
• Fire-Resistant Materials and Systems: Investigating fire-resistant materials, compartmentation, and fire suppression systems to enhance building safety.
• Energy-Efficient Disaster-Resistant Design: Integrating sustainable and energy-efficient design principles into disaster-resistant architectural solutions.
• Community Resilience and Infrastructure: Understanding the role of community planning, emergency management, and critical infrastructure in creating disaster-resilient communities.
• Innovative Disaster-Resistant Materials and Technologies: Exploring the latest advancements in disaster-resistant materials, construction techniques, and smart technologies for enhanced building performance.
• Case Studies in Disaster-Resistant Architecture: Analyzing real-world examples of successful disaster-resistant architectural innovations and their impact on communities.
